I had heard there was a story in the paper but hadn't seen it.

I drive the 382 a lot, in fact I've just done one. I think it's safe to say there are more people in that photograph than have been on my bus in the last two weeks added up.

Today, I had one person get off at The Retreat just before Littleworth and one other riding all the way through to Eckington. On the return journey I carried two people who both got off the bus by Defford and then I was empty until Norton Barracks.

I don't want to see the route cut but the fact is that nobody, and I really do mean nobody, is using it between Norton Barracks and Defford, other than those taking the scenic route to through to Pershore.
